CC   Original source text: Herpes simplex virus type 2 (strain 333) DNA
CC   [4]; clone pDG401, fragment BC24 [3]; clone pP2 (derivative of
CC   pDG401) [1].
CC   [5] revises [3]. Draft entry and sequence in computer readable form
CC   for [3], [1], [2], [4] and [5] kindly provided by M.A.Swain,
CC   04-NOV-1986. An insertion-like sequence is present from position
CC   5482-5627 [3]. A TATA box for the 5.0 kb mRNA is located at
CC   positions 148-153 and a TATA box for the 1.2 kb mRNA is located at
CC   positions 3742-3747. A poly-adenylation signal for the 5.0 kb and
CC   1.2 kb mRNAs is found at positions 4954-4959.
